In this final episode of our conversation Mr. Sayani talks about his friendship with music director Roshan, who is Hrithik Roshan’s grandfather.
We also get to hear Mr. Sayani’s thoughts about the quality of the current radio shows in India.
Besides radio what keeps Mr. Sayani occupied these days? It is a new project called “Crisis in Communication.” Tune in to find out about it.
